Hi Dave I needed to speak to my energy supplier about coming to read the meter anyway, and when I explained I couldn't read it myself, and preferred an actual reading to estimated bills, they were very helpful. They offered me Braille statements, and someone to come out and see if they could put tactile controls or bump-ons on the system. They are coming later this month to read the meter and assess the system in one go. But I explained that I really want the thermostat to talk, or something that would indicate to me what everything is set to. I don't need bump-ons as the system on the whole is tactile enough. I thanked them for the offer of Braille statements though, that is useful. I was pleased that at least they bothered to help, not all of the utility companies are so forthcoming.
